Cory had insisted that he give Maya and Riley a ride back to campus when maya insisted that she go to her dorm instead of back to the Matthews.

She just wanted to bury herself in her room, under her covers and not come out until she had to.

She had been so stupid. So stupid this whole year that it took until now for her to realize it. Just how much she wanted to be with Josh, and now knowing just how much he wanted to be with her.

She sighed as she clenched her fists together. She wasn't going to cry, not now. Not in front of Cory and Riley. She would wait until she was in the comfort of her room, where nobody could see or hear her.

As they pulled up into campus, Maya was quick to unbuckle and start getting out of the car. A hand reached out and grabbed her own, she looked up into the eyes of the man who had been like a father to her for so long.

"I know, things might seem hopeless right now.  But if there is anyone that could survive this, it's you and Josh." Cory told her. Maya couldn't bring herself to smile at him. So instead she squeezed his hand and gave him a slight nod before getting out of the car. Riley right behind her.

They both were quiet as they entered into their dorm building, Maya felt like she could break again at any moment, and Riley noticed how on edge she seemed.

"Maya-" Riley started. But she didn't seem to know what to say, so she cut herself off.

"It's okay, Riley. Really, I'll be okay." Maya told her. "But I would like to be alone for right now."

"Are you sure? I don't want to leave you by yourself." Riley said. Maya shook her head and was able to give her best friend a fake smile.

"I'm fine. I promise." Maya told her. Riley knew it was a lie, but she decided to give her friend some space for right now. She leaned in and gave Maya a hug before turning around and walking back down the hall.

Maya sighed as she continued to walk towards her dorm room. She wrapped her arms around herself as if she could comfort herself. She didn't want people to see how pathetic she was, how she was about to go into her dorm room and cry the rest of the day away. She wasn't in the mood for sympathy either.

The door was unlocked, causing Maya to narrow her eyebrows in confusion. It wasn't like Riley to leave their dorm room unlocked when they go away for the night. And maya knew that she wouldn't ever do it.

She opened the door cautiously, keeping her eyes on the floor as she walked in. The first thing she did was look over towards the closet, but there were too many clothes and boxes in the way that she was sure nobody could really climb behind and hide.

"Hi." Maya jumped at the voice that had come from the corner of her room. She snapped her head over and her heart seemed to have stopped.

"Josh." She gasped out in shock. "W-what-" she couldn't bring herself to finish her sentence, she couldn't believe that he was here. Josh stood up from the desk chair.

"I made it half way to the airport when I realized, we never really got the chance to say a proper goodbye." He told her. He was hesitant to make his way over to her, he didn't know how she would react.

"But you-how did you-" Maya still seemed unable to form words as everything jumbled up in her head in confusion. Josh gave a slight smirk.

"I kind of picked the lock." He told her as he held up a bobby-pin. "That's one thing they don't teach you in Quantico." He joked lightly. "I couldn't leave without seeing you first." He whispered.

"But I just saw your plane leave at the airport." Maya told him, finally able to come to her senses a little bit. Josh stared at her for a moment.

"You-you were at the airport?" It was his turn to be confused. Maya nodded her head.

"I talked with Cory and Topanga, and I read your letter. And it made me realized something. Something I should have known a long time ago." Maya told him. Josh had a slight grin on his face.

"You did? Like what?" He asked her. Maya swallowed hard as she took him in. He was standing there, right in front of her. After she thought she had lost him for good, he came back to her. And she wasn't going to let him go this time.

"I don't want you to get on that plane." Maya told him. Her breath starting to become uneven. "I want you to stay here in New York. I want you to stay here with me." She whispered the last part.

Josh closed his eyes and let out a long breath that he had seemed to be holding. It was a breath of relief, a breath of happiness.

"I was really hoping you'd say that." And with two long strides, he was taking her into his arms and planting his lips on hers.

It didn't take long for Maya to adjust before she wrapped her arms around his neck and deepened the kiss, Josh pulling her closer and tightly against him.

That kiss said everything that needed to be said between them. How much they loved each other, how much they cared. How much they wanted to be with one another.

After a minute, they both pulled back and tested their foreheads against each other's. Josh had the biggest smile on his face, and Maya leaned her head down to rest on his shoulder as he pulled her into a hug.

"I'm not going anywhere." He told her.

"I'm sorry, I'm sorry it took me so long-"

"Stop." Josh cut her off. "None of that matters anymore." He stated. He brought her chin up so that her eyes met his. "The only thing that matters is this, right here and right now. All you ever had to do was tell me to stay, Maya. That's all I've been waiting on."

"You really want to do this?" Maya asked him. "I'm a mess, I have a lot of issues and baggage-"

"You're perfect." Josh cut her off again. "Inside and out."

"But what are you going to do about your job?" Maya asked him. Josh shrugged his shoulders, not being able to bring himself to care at the moment.

"They can live without me." He told her. Maya leaned up and kissed him again. Bringing her arms down to wrap around his torso instead of his neck.

"I love you." She told him. Josh grinned and kissed her on the forehead, bringing her closer into him for a hug.

Within that moment, they both knew that they had all they had ever wanted. Maya had been in love with Josh since practically middle school, she dreamed of a life with him from the time she was thirteen years old.

Josh had finally found his fairytale ending that he had wanted since before he could walk.

They both knew, that they had finally gotten their dreams come true.

"I love you, too."
